Part Number AD640JPZ-REEL7 |
Category Linear - Amplifiers - Instrumentation, OP Amps, Buffer Amps |
Manufacturer Analog Devices Inc. |
Description IC OPAMP LOGARITHMC 1CIRC 20PLCC |
Package Bulk |
Series - |
Operating Temperature 0°C ~ 70°C |
Mounting Type Surface Mount |
Package / Case 20-LCC (J-Lead) |
Supplier Device Package 20-PLCC (9x9) |
Current - Supply 35mA |
Output Type - |
Number of Circuits 1 |
Voltage - Supply, Single/Dual (±) ±4.5V ~ 7.5V |
Current - Output / Channel 2.3 mA |
-3db Bandwidth 350 MHz |
Amplifier Type Logarithmic |
Current - Input Bias 7 µA |
Voltage - Input Offset 50 µV |
Slew Rate - |
Gain Bandwidth Product - |
Package_case 20-LCC (J-Lead) |
